Visible to Intel only — GUID: GUID-E35E4726-E046-4337-A131-4F6DD6C20D54
Visible to Intel only — GUID: GUID-E35E4726-E046-4337-A131-4F6DD6C20D54
fsycl-unnamed-lambda
Enables unnamed SYCL* lambda kernels.
Syntax
Linux: |
-fsycl-unnamed-lambda -fno-sycl-unnamed-lambda |
Windows: |
-fsycl-unnamed-lambda -fno-sycl-unnamed-lambda |
Arguments
None
Default
ON |
Unnamed SYCL lambda kernels are enabled. |
Description
This option enables unnamed SYCL kernels that are defined as lambdas.
When using this option, you must also specify option -fsycl.
If you specify -fno-sycl-unnamed-lambda, unnamed SYCL lambda kernels are disabled.
For information about available SYCL drivers, refer to Invoke the Compiler.
When SYCL offloading is enabled, this option only applies to device-specific compilation.
IDE Equivalent
Visual Studio: DPC++ > General > Allow unnamed SYCL lambda kernels
Eclipse: Intel(R) oneAPI DPC++ Compiler > Language > Allow unnamed SYCL lambda kernels
Alternate Options
None